  • Background: In malignancies, detection of metastatic foci is of value in making therapeutic plans for treatment of disease and prevention of life-threatening complications. Common sites for metastasis of bronchogenic cancer include lymph nodes, liver, brain, adrenals and bone. Skull, vertebrae, ribs and long bones are common sites for bone metastasis. But in epidermoid carcinoma, the incidence of bone metastasis is relatively low and especially to the distal phalangeal bone is rare. Methods: We experienced a case of epidermoid carcinoma with the first distant metastasis to the fifth distal phalangeal bone, right toe. Results: The initial stage in the diagnosis of epidermoid carcinoma was T4N3MO. During the third round of anticancer chemotherapy, we recognized the distant metastasis to the fifth distal phalangeal bone for the first time. Localized abnormal findings were noted by bone X-ray and scanning. By a histopathologic examination of the amputated toe, we confirmed the metastasis of epidrmoid bronchogenic carcinoma. Conclusion: If localized abnormal finding is discovered at an unusual site for metastasis, we recommend physicians to consider the possibility of metastasis even though it is very low.

  • The present study was carried out to investigate the potential adverse effects of CKD-602 by a 5-day repeated intravenous dose in Sprague-Dawley rats. The test article, CKD-602, was administered intravenously to male and female rats at dose levels of 0.07, 0.22, 0.67, 2.0 and 6.0 mg/kg/day for 5 days consecutively. Mortalities, clinical findings, and body weight changes were monitored for the 14-day period after cessation of the administration. At the end of 14-day observation period, all animals were sacrificed and complete gross postmortem examinations were performed. There were 2 and 5 treatment related deaths in the 0.67 and 2.0 mg/kg/day dose groups of both genders, respectively. Treatment related clinical signs, including hair loss, skin paleness, decreased locomotor activity, emaciation, and changes in stool were observed in a dose-dependent manner from the third day after initiation of the injection. Decrease or suppression of body weight was also observed dose-dependently in males and females of the treated groups. Gross postmortem examinations revealed a dose-dependent increase in the incidence and severity of atrophy or hypertrophy and white membrane formation in the spleen, atrophy of the thymus, diffuse white spots and paleness of the liver, paleness of the lung, kidney and adrenal gland, and dark red discoloration and dark red contents in the alimentary tract. Based on these results, it was concluded that the 5-repeated intravenous injection of CKD-602 to male and female rats resulted in increased incidence of abnormal clinical signs and death, decreased or suppressed body weight, and increased incidence of abnormal gross findings. In the present experimental conditions, the $LD_{50}$ value was 2.07 (95% confidence limit not specified) mg/kg/day in both genders and the $LD_{10}$ value was 1.72 (95% confidence limit not specified) mg/kg/day in both genders.

  • The present study was carried out to investigate the potential acute toxicity of amitraz by a single subcutaneous dose in beagle dogs. The test chemical was administered subcutaneously to male beagle dogs at dose levels of 0, 2, 10, or 50 mg/kg. Mortalities, clinical findings, and body weight changes were monitored for the 14-day period following the administration. At the end of 14-day observation period, hematology, serum biochemistry, and gross postmortem examinations were examined. A single dog in the 50 mg/kg group was found dead on day 3 after treatment and the other two dogs in the group were sacrificed because of the severe clinical signs on day 7 after treatment. Treatment related clinical signs, including anorexia, edema, mass and abscess formation in the injection sites, depression, vomiting, lacrimation, decreased locomotor activity, ataxia, recumbency, paresis in the limbs, and/or moribundity were observed in all treatment groups in a dose-dependent manner. Decreased or suppressed body weight gain was also observed dose-dependently in all treated groups. In autopsy, dead animals in the 50 mg/kg group showed muscular hemorrhage and inflammation in the injection sites and congestion in the liver and kidney. The terminal sacrificed animals in the 10 mg/kg group also exhibited muscular hemorrhage and inflammation in the injection sites. Whereas, no treatment related effects on hematology and serum biochemistry were observed on day 14 after treatment at any dose tested. On the basis of the results, it was concluded that a single subcutaneous injection of amitraz to beagle dogs resulted in increased incidence of abnormal clinical signs and death, decreased body weight, and increased incidence of abnormal gross findings. In the experimental conditions, the $LD_{50}$value of amitraz was 22.3 mg/kg (95% confidence limit not specified) and the no-observed-adverse-effect level (NOAEL) was considered to be below 2 mg/kg for male dogs.

  • Objective : Recently scolopendrid aqua-acupuncture has been a good effect on pain control but it has not been known about clinical safety. The purpose of this study was to investigate acute toxicity of scolopendrid aqua-acupuncture. Method : In order to prove the clinical safety of scolopendrid aqua-acupuncture, We have observed a bacteriological examination and clinical pathology test after scolopendrid aqua-acupuncture treatment. Balb/c mice were injected intravenous with Scolopendrid aquaacupuncture treatment for $LD_{50}$ and acute toxicity test. We analyzed physical reaction(side effect)and clinical pathology test before and after Scolopendrid aqua-acupuncture treatment of mice and 20 patients suffering from pain, who admitted department of Acupunture and Moxibustion, College of Oriental Medicine, Won-Kwang University Kwangju hospital. Results : In the Blood agar plate and Nutrient agar plate, a bacteriological examination did not show a bacillus. In acute $LD_{50}$ toxicity test, there was no mortality thus unable to attain the value. Examining the toxic response in the acute toxicity test, there was no sign of toxication. In acute toxic test, running biochemical serum test couldn't yield any differences between the control and experiment groups. In the 20 patients treated with Scolopendrid aqua-acupuncture, hematologic test did not show remarkable change. In the 20 patients treated with Scolopendrid aqua-acupuncture, Liver function test(AST, ALT, ALP) showed a slight decrease on the contrary, and abnormal rate showed a decrease of 5.0% compared with previous study. Reanl function test(BUN, Cr) and abnormal rate showed a decrease of 5.0% compared with previous study. In the 20 patients treated with Scolopendrid aqua-acupuncture, Electrolyte were normal range before and after treatment. In the Urine analysis of 20 patients, Leukocyte, Protein, Glucose, Keton, Bilirubin, U-bilinogen were not detected before and after Scolopendrid aqua-acupuncture treatment, and the rest almost made no difference.

We've compared and analyzed Occidental and Oriental medical causes, symptoms and treatments of Primary trigeminal neuralgia and wanted to get better effects by a cooperative analysis. So the examination and analysis of the recent treatment tendency and reference bibliography show the following results. 1. Trigeminal neuralgia is nerve systematic disease appearing in the distribution scope of trigeminal nerve. It's characterized by extreme pain accompanying with a repeated and simultaneous fit from several seconds to 1-2 minutes. 2. Though there are many hypothesis on the trigeminal neuralgia, but now many doctors agree that when trigeminal nerve is under the local out of sheath conditions resulting from receiving a chronic stimulus, and the nucleus of trigeminal nerve fire, owing to decrease of pain control function and abnormal occurrence of action potential, it would be appeared. 3. The Oriental medical name of trigeminal neuralgia is generally Dootong, Doopoong, Myuntong, Pyundootong, Pyundoopoong, and Myuntong is the nearest in Occidental medicine. 4. The Oriental medical cause of trigeminal neuralgia is usually divided into Wekam and Naesang. The first one is caused by Poonghan, Poongyul, Damhwa and wicked energy enter into the body, the mechanical energy is obstructed and can't move any more, so the pain appears by them. The other cause is the hurt by emotion. And it would be loss of the transportain of liver and obstructed, so result into Kanwulhwahwa, Kanpoongnaedong and the pain appears. 5. There are two methods of curing trigeminal neuralgia. As a medication, primary method is prescribing Carbamazepine and the second is using Phenytoin or Baclofen. And as a operation, Drug injection of trigeminal nerve, Amputation of branches of trigeminal nerve, Retrogasserian glycerol rhizotomy, Radiofrequency gangliolysis, Neurovascular decompression can be used. 6. There are several herb medicines for Trigeminal neuralgia. First, Chungung is good for Hwaejeetong, Keopoongjedam, Hwalhyuljeetong. Second, Jeongal, Jiryong, Okong is used for Sikpoonghekyung, Tongkyungjeetong. Third, Baekjee, Sesin, Cheonma, Manhyungja is efficacious in Sinonhepyo. Sanpoongjeetong. Fourth, for falling of liver's Wulhwa, Yongdamcho, Hyungge, Kukwha can be used. And also Saengjihwang, Hwangkm is good for going down the fever of Yangmyungwiyul and finally, Baekkangjam. Moryu can be effective for Jaumjamyang, Haekyungjitong. The other medicines can be used as assistant analgesics, and it also efficacious. 7. Generally the points of pain on the face and the points of Soyangkyung and Yangmyungkyung is used for Acupuntual therapy, because the two meridians passed on the face. Hakwan. Sabaek, Kwanryo, Keoryo, Hyubkeo, Taeyang, Jeechang, Younghyang, Eoyo, Chanjuk. Yangbaek. Sajukkong. Dooyoo, Kwangsangjum, Sengjang, Poongjee is used for taking near point and Joksamlee, Naejung, Habkok is used for taking distant point. 8. Dansam or Danggui injection which have a effect for Hwalhyulhwaeo, Sokyunghwalak and Vit B1, Vit B2, Vit B12, $2\%$ Hydrochloroprocaine, $1\%$ Lidocaine injection to pain point for local analgesics had so good effect. And external application and moxibustion are used for another treatment. 9. It proved that through mouse model, both Herb medication group and Drug medication group are efficacious for trigeminal neuralgia similarly and also the cooperative medication group shows more effective result than the only drug medication group.

  • Bronchial carcinoid tumors are uncommon, constituting approximately 5% of all primary lung cancers. Carcinoid tumors belong to the calss of neuroendocrine tumors that consist of cells that can store and secrete neuramines and neuropeptides. Neuroendocrine tumors of the lung include three pathologic types : a low-grade malignancy, the so-called 'typical carcinoid', a more aggressive tumor, the "atypical carcinoid", and the most aggressive malignant neoplasm, the small-cell carcinoma. Atypical carcinoid tumor have a higher malignant potential, is more commonly peripheral than is the typical carcinoid tumor. Histologic features would characterize a carcinoid as hitologically atypical : increased mitotic activity, pleomorphism and irregularity of neuclei with promonent nucleoli, hyperchromatin, and abnormal nuclear-cytoplasmic ratio, areas of increased cellularity with disorganization of architecture, and areas of tumor necrosis. Metastatic involvement of regional lymph nodes and distant organ is common. The prognosis is related to size of the tumor, typical of atypical appearance, endoluminal of extraluminal growth, vascular invasion, node metastasis, Pulmonary resection is the treatement of choice for bronchial carcinoid. We experienced one case of bronchopulmonary atypical carcinoid tumor. In the case, radiologic study showed solitary lung mass with liver metastasis and the level of 5-HIAA was elevated. There was no history of cutaneous flushing, diarrhea, valvular heart disease. The authors reported a case of bronchopulmonary atypical carcinoid tumor with review of literatures.

  • In order to examine the toxicity of palatinose-L (Pal-L) bioconverted from sucrose, we performed a 14-consecutive day toxicity study with male and female Sprague-Dawley (SD) rats. We recorded clinical signs of toxicity, body weight, organ weights, hematology, blood biochemical, urinalysis, histological changes in organs, such as the liver and kidneys, and clinical chemistry analysis data for all SD rats. There were no significant changes in food/water consumption, body weight, and organ weights during the experimental period. Although there were some hematologic and urinalysis alterations, these changes were not considered toxicologically significant. In addition, histopathological examination of the liver and kidneys revealed no abnormal or toxicological changes between the control and Pal-L-treated rats of both sexes. Collectively, these results suggest that Pal-L was not indicated to have any toxicity in the SD rats when it was orally administered up to a dose of 1,000 mg/kg/day for 14 days.

  • This study was performed to identify the differentially methylated region (DMR) and to examine the mRNA expression of the imprinted H19 gene in day 35 of SCNT pig fetuses. The fetus and placenta at day 35 of gestation fetuses after natural mating (Control) or of cloned pig by somatic cell nuclear transfer (SCNT) were isolated from a uterus. To investigate the mRNA expression and methylation patterns of H19 gene, tissues from fetal liver and placenta including endometrial and extraembryonic tissues were collected. The mRNA expression was evaluated by real-time PCR and methylation pattern was analyzed by bisulfite sequencing method. Bisulfite analyses demonstrated that the differentially methylated region (DMR) was located between -1694 bp to -1338 bp upstream from translation start site of the H19 gene. H19 DMR (-1694 bp to -1338 bp) exhibits a normal mono allelic methylation pattern, and heavily methylated in sperm, but not in oocyte. In contrast to these finding, the analysis of the endometrium and/or extraembryonic tissues from SCNT embryos revealed a complex methylation pattern. The DNA methylation status of DMR Region In porcine H19 gene upstream was hypo methylated in SCNT tissues but hypermethylated in control tissues. Furthermore, the mRNA expression of H19 gene in liver, endometrium, and extraembryonic tissues was significantly higher in SCNT than those of control (p<0.05). These results suggest that the aberrant mRNA expression and the abnormal methylation pattern of imprinted H19 gene might be closely related to the inadequate fetal development of a cloned fetus, contributing to the low efficiency of genomic reprogramming.

  • Single and repeated-dose toxicity of anti-diabetic herb extract microcapsule (ADHEM) were evaluated according to Toxicity Test Guidelines of Korea Food and Drug Administration using Sprague-Dawley rats. For single-dose toxicity test, kneading ADHEM with sterilized water were administered orally once at dose levels of 0 and 2,000 mg/kg and examined for 14 days. No dead animals, clinical signs and abnormal necropsy findings were observed and also no significant difference in body weights was found. Therefore, the $LD_{50}$ of ADHEM was considered to be higher than 2,000 mg/kg in both male and female rats. For repeated-dose toxicity test, ADHEM were mixed with powder fodder and administerd orally for 28 days at dose levels of 0, 500, 1000 and 2000 mg/kg/day. No dead animals, clinical signs and significant difference in body weights were found. In hematology and serum biochemistry, all values were included within the normal ranges. In relative organ weights, kidney or liver were significantly increased in the 500, 1000 or 2000 mg/kg/day male groups, uterus was significantly increased in the 500 mg/kg/day female group and left adrenal glands were significantly decreased in the 2000 mg/kg/day female group. In histopathological examinations, vacuolation and microgranuloma in the liver, chronic progressive nephropathy and inflammation in the kidney were observed in the 500, 1000 or 2000 mg/kg/day both male and female groups. Therefore, the no observed adverse effect level (NOAEL) of ADHEM was considered to be lower than 500 mg/kg/day in both male and female rats.

  • tert-Butyl acetate is an organic solvent used for coatings, industrial cleaning, and surface treatment applications. This study investigated the potential adverse effects of tert-butyl acetate on pregnant dams and embryo-fetal development after maternal exposure on gestational days 6 through 19 in rats. The test chemical was administered to pregnant rats by gavage at dose levels of 0, 500, 1,000, 1,500, and 2,000 mg/kg/day. All dams were subjected to a caesarean section on day 20 of gestation and their fetuses were examined for any external, visceral, and skeletal abnormalities. At 2,000 mg/kg, treatment-related clinical signs, including piloerection, abnormal gait, decreased locomotor activity, loss of fur, reddish tear, anorexia, nasal discharge, vocalization and coma, were observed in a dose-dependent manner. All dams died between the 2nd day and 5th day of treatment due to a severe systemic toxicity. At 1,500 mg/kg, minimal maternal toxicity including an increase in the incidence of decreased locomotor activity and loss of fur, and an increase in the weights of adrenal glands and liver was observed. On the contrary, no significant adverse effect on the embryo-fetal development was detected. There were no adverse effects on either pregnant dams or embryo-fetal development at <1,000 mg/kg. These results show that a 14-day repeated oral dose of tert-butyl acetate in rats caused a minimal maternal toxicity including increases in the incidence of clinical signs and the weights of adrenal glands and liver, but no embryotoxicity and teratogenicity at 1,500 mg/kg/day. Under these experimental conditions, the no-observed-adverse-effect level (NOAEL) of tert-butyl acetate is estimated to be 1,000 mg/kg per day for dams and 1,500 mg/kg per day for embryo-fetal development.
